Steps to Create a QR Code for a Google Form

Here are the steps to make a QR code for your Google Form. This will help your audience easily access and fill out your form. Just follow these instructions to make the process smoother and increase user engagement.

Step 1: Create Your Google Form

Before creating a QR code, you need to have your Google Form or any other online form ready. If you haven't created one yet, follow these simple steps:

  • Open your web browser and go to Google Forms.

  • Click on the "+" button or "Blank" to create a new form.

  • Input your questions, options, and any other necessary information for your form. You can customize your form by changing the theme, adding images, and more.

Once your form is ready, you need to get its URL to create a QR code.

  • In the top right corner, click on the "Send" button.

  • Select the link icon (the chain symbol), then click on "Copy" to copy the form's URL.

Step 3: Create the QR Code

Now that you have the URL, you can create a QR code. You can find free QR code generators online like QR Code Generator, Canva QR code generator, or QRCode Monkey.

  • In the QR code generator, paste the link you copied from your Google Form.
  • Click on the button to generate the QR code.
  • Save the generated QR code image to your computer.
  • Use this QR code in your documents, presentations, posters, or anywhere you need.

Benefits of Using QR Codes

1. Accessibility

QR codes simplify access to information. Users can quickly scan the qr code with their smartphones, eliminating the need to type long URLs or search for specific content manually.

2. User Experience

They provide a seamless and user-friendly experience, allowing customers or users to interact with businesses or organizations effortlessly.

3. Data Collection

QR codes make it easier for businesses to collect customer feedback, conduct surveys, and gather contact information at events.

4. Versatility

QR codes are versatile and can be used in various settings such as marketing, education, product packaging, and event management.

Practical Applications of QR Codes

1. Marketing Campaigns

Integrate QR codes into marketing materials such as posters, flyers, and social media posts to drive traffic to landing pages, promotions, or product information.

By scanning the code, potential customers can instantly access special offers, video content, or detailed product descriptions, enhancing the effectiveness of your marketing efforts.

2. Event Management

Use QR codes for event registration, attendee check-ins, and feedback surveys. They simplify logistics and enhance attendee engagement.

By scanning a QR code, attendees can quickly register for the event, check-in upon arrival, and provide immediate feedback, streamlining the entire event process.

3. Retail and E-commerce

Incorporate QR codes on product labels or packaging to provide customers with detailed product information, user manuals, or warranty registration.

This allows customers to access important information instantly, improving their overall shopping experience. QR codes can also link to promotional videos or customer reviews, helping to boost sales.

4. Educational Settings

Facilitate learning by embedding QR codes in textbooks, worksheets, or classroom displays to access supplementary resources, quizzes, or interactive content.

Teachers can use QR codes to direct students to educational videos, additional readings, or interactive exercises, making learning more dynamic and engaging.

5. Contactless Transactions

QR codes enable contactless payments, ticketing, or ordering services, promoting hygiene and convenience in various business operations.

Customers can scan a QR code to make payments, receive tickets, or place orders without physical contact, ensuring a safer and more efficient transaction process.

6. Healthcare Services

In healthcare settings, QR codes can be used for patient check-ins, accessing medical records, or scheduling appointments.

Patients can scan a code to quickly register their visit, retrieve their health information, or book follow-up appointments, enhancing the efficiency of healthcare services and reducing waiting times.

7. Hospitality Industry

Hotels and restaurants can use QR codes to provide menus, facilitate check-ins, or offer guest services. Guests can scan a QR code to view the menu, place orders, check-in to their rooms, or request services such as housekeeping or room service, improving their overall experience.

8. Real Estate

Real estate agents can place QR codes on property listings, signs, and brochures to provide virtual tours, additional photos, or detailed property information.

Potential buyers can scan the code to get a comprehensive view of the property, schedule a visit, or contact the agent directly, making the property search more convenient and informative.

9. Transportation

In public transportation, QR codes can be used for ticketing, route information, and schedules. Passengers can scan a QR code to purchase tickets, view real-time route updates, or access timetables, improving their travel experience and reducing the need for physical tickets or printed schedules.

10. Entertainment and Media

QR codes can enhance the experience in theaters, museums, and amusement parks by providing additional information, interactive content, or digital guides.

Visitors can scan a QR code to learn more about exhibits, watch behind-the-scenes videos, or access digital maps, making their visit more engaging and informative.
